Transponder Keys

If you own a vehicle that was manufactured in the recent 20 years or so, it's likely that it uses a transponder key. This is because transponder keys are utilized by a variety of automakers to prevent theft. They are also more difficult to duplicate, and the car can only start when it recognizes the unique serial number.

They also have a microchip which is programmed to match your vehicle's code. This ensures that only you are able to use your vehicle. These keys have a rubber or plastic head, and the chip is typically located in it. These keys are sometimes called "chip keys" and "transponder key". If you own transponder keys, you will need to bring it to a locksmith in order to have it copied or replaced.

Many people believe that only auto dealerships can make replacement keys, but this is not true. A skilled locksmith can make keys for a lot less than what the dealership would charge. Dealers may charge more because they have a lot of overhead costs.

A professional locksmith has the tools required to create these replacement remote car keys keys for almost any kind of vehicle, so they can provide you with a competitive price. These keys are likely to be superior to the ones you can purchase from an auto dealer.

These keys are also available at local stores like Walmart, Home Depot and AutoZone. They also carry various accessories can be used with these keys, including remote start systems. In some instances you might be in a position to program the keys yourself, based on the model and make of your vehicle.

To accomplish this, you'll require a programming tool that's compatible with the vehicle you have. You'll then need to follow the instructions on how to program your key. This can be tricky but it's worth the effort if want to avoid paying a high cost for a car key replacement.

Key Fobs

When people use the term "key fob" today, they're talking about an electronic device used to control access to a vehicle. Key fobs are designed to be compact, convenient and easy to use. They are a convenient alternative to traditional keys, because they are able to unlock and start vehicles remotely. Some keys come with additional features such as panic buttons, GPS tracking capabilities.

Key fobs resemble normal keys, but they have additional features. They can unlock or lock doors remotely and also start the car engine and open a trunk or solar roof that can power. They can also send a signal or make chirping sounds to help drivers locate their car key battery replacement near me in crowded lots.

Most modern cars utilize key fobs instead of traditional keys. They are safer, since they require a specific authentication signal to function. They can be removed by the owner making them harder for thieves to use.

Key fobs can be a bit confusing to use, even though they're useful. It can be difficult to understand what each button does on a device that has many buttons. For instance, if we press the lock button, it could also trigger the power windows, which could be a big problem in a storm. The key fob can also have other functions like opening and closing the power sunroof and activating the headlights.

If you have lost your key fob you can usually get it replaced by an automotive locksmith. They will be able cut the blanks for you and program the new key so that it works with your vehicle. You can also purchase an alternative key fob from several stores, like AutoZone. The staff member will be able to help you find the right one for your car and guide you on how to use it.

If you want to ensure that your key fob works properly, follow the tips below. It is important to monitor the battery of your keyfob to look for signs of low battery. This could include a loss of signal strength or buttons that are not responding. Refer to the owner's manual for more detailed instructions on how to fix the issue in the event that your key fob is not working.

Smart Keys

Smart keys are now accessible for many vehicles, and you don't have to stick with the traditional groove-cut key. These keys offer a variety of benefits that make them worth the investment.

Smart car keys can be used as a flip key to lock and unlock your vehicle however, they also function as remotes. The smart key to control a variety of features of your car, including the sunroof and windows. You can even lock your car remotely via an app for your smartphone. This is great for parents who are busy or children who forget to lock the trunk after having put on their grocery bags.

They also assist in protect against theft. Smart keys transmit a code to the vehicle's Immobilizer System, which verifies that the fob is genuine before allowing the vehicle to start. The vehicle will stop the engine in the event of an unauthentic key fob.

In addition to the added security, smart keys can assist in removing the old adage - "I have my car keys somewhere". They only need to be within reach to open doors or start the engine and they can do this without having to touch any controls in the vehicle. They can also be programmed to connect to your smartphone via Bluetooth, which can provide additional convenience by the ability to unlock or lock your car key battery replacement at the touch of one button.

These systems are not capable of protecting you from all kinds of thieves. Researchers and hackers are always able to come up with ways to thwart the latest technology, which is why having a backup key is important in the event of losing yours.
